Brazilian National Arrested at OR Tambo with R4.2 Million Worth of Cocaine

JOHANNESBURG – A 25-year-old Brazilian drug trafficker was arrested at OR Tambo International Airport on Tuesday, 29 July 2025, after arriving from São Paulo via Doha.

Acting on intelligence, a joint team comprising Crime Intelligence Counter Narcotics Intel Gauteng, ORTIA SAPS Tactical Team, the Border Management Authority (BMA), and private security intercepted the suspect shortly after landing.

A search of his luggage uncovered about 10kg of cocaine with an estimated street value of R4.2 million. The suspect was also taken for a medical examination to determine whether he had swallowed cocaine-filled pellets.

SAPS says the arrest forms part of ongoing efforts to dismantle transnational drug syndicates, with more than 25 drug traffickers apprehended at this port of entry since the start of the year.
